The Randomness of Casino Games

One of the most widespread misconceptions about casinos is that the outcomes of games can be manipulated or predicted. Many players believe that specific strategies or patterns can lead to consistent wins, particularly in games like slots and roulette. However, most casino games are designed to ensure random outcomes, utilizing Random Number Generators (RNGs) to guarantee fairness. This means every spin or deal is independent, and previous results have no influence on future outcomes. The belief that a “hot” or “cold” streak can be exploited is fundamentally flawed. Just because a slot machine pays out frequently does not mean it will continue to do so. Each game session is a new opportunity, and the odds remain constant. Understanding this can help players make more informed choices and manage their expectations in both online and offline casinos.

The House Edge Explained

Another common myth revolves around the idea that the house always wins due to unfair rules. While it’s true that casinos have a built-in advantage known as the house edge, this doesn’t mean that players are doomed to lose every time they gamble. The house edge varies from game to game, and in some instances, skilled players can reduce it significantly through strategy.

For example, in games like blackjack, basic strategy can lower the house edge to less than 1%. Understanding the nuances of different games can empower players and enhance their overall experience. It’s crucial to approach gambling with the knowledge of these odds and to remember that while the house has an advantage, skill and strategy can influence outcomes in certain games.

The Myth of “Hot” and “Cold” Machines

Many players hold the belief that slot machines go through phases of being “hot” or “cold,” where players can win big or will experience prolonged losses. This myth creates the false impression that players can predict when to play a machine for maximum payout. In reality, each slot machine operates independently, with no correlation to past performance.

The results from slot machines are determined by RNGs, meaning that every spin is a completely new event with no ties to previous spins. Players should approach slot gaming with the understanding that outcomes are random and not influenced by prior results. This perspective can help mitigate frustration and disappointment.
